ABOUT HUNTSMAN ENTERTAINMENT
Ron Huntsman has been part of the Nashville entertainment industry since 1970. In 1988, Ron and Vivian Huntsman established Huntsman Entertainment, Inc as a full-service radio promotion, program and audio content producer and marketer. Each year, radio stations across the United States and Canada air one or more of the company’s programs, including Country HitMakerssm, the Artist Clip Servicesm, Christmas on Music Rowsm and Live from Nashville!sm
Huntsman Entertainment has produced over 150 album premieres and one-time long and short-form specials for artists such as Garth Brooks, Taylor Swift, Keith Urban, Faith Hill, Brooks & Dunn and many others.
In addition to radio specials, lifestyle program production and marketing has included Michael Martin Murphey’s WestFest Radio Network, Country Salutes Lonesome Dove, Red Steagall’s Cowboy Corner and all domestic and foreign radio broadcasts of The Charlie Daniels Volunteer Jam Concert Series.
